How much do part time data entry j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time data entry in Topeka, KS is $18.33,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$20.58 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a part time data entry?

A Part Time Data Entry job involves inputting, updating, and maintaining data in computer systems or databases. Responsibilities may include typing information from documents, verifying accuracy, and organizing records. These jobs are typically flexible, allowing individuals to work limited hours based on employer needs. They are commonly found in industries like healthcare, finance, retail, and administration. Basic computer skills, attention to detail, and typing proficiency are usually required.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a part time data entry professional?

As a Part Time Data Entry professional, your daily tasks typically include entering and updating information into databases or spreadsheets, verifying the accuracy of data, and organizing digital files. You may also be responsible for cross-referencing data sources, flagging discrepancies, and sometimes scanning documents to digitize paper records. Depending on the employer, you might collaborate with other team members or departments to clarify information or retrieve missing data. Attention to detail and consistent workflow are crucial, as your work directly supports accurate business oper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the part time data entry position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Data Entry professional, you need strong attention to detail, fast and accurate typing skills, and at least a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with spreadsheet software (like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ets), database management systems, and sometimes experience with industry-specific platforms is beneficial. Dependability, time management, and the ability to work independently or with minimal supervision are valuable soft skills in this role. These competencies ensure data integrity, efficient workflow, and reliable support for broader organizational operations.

DISPATCHER

Starting at $22.90 / hour with credit given for experience

We're hiring a Dispatcher to receive, record, and effectively manage requests for ambulance assistance/transport from various sources.

This position works 12-hour shifts, primarily at night. Shifts may be overnight and on weekends and holidays.

Responsibilities:

  • Understands and adequately implements the concepts of Emergency Medical Dispatch as published in Principles of Emergency Medical Dispatch (and as customized by AMR) as a minimum standard of care.
  • Allocates EMS resources properly as the need arises by application of appropriate decision-making rules and approved protocols.
  • Responsible and accountable for completeness and accuracy of paperwork related to his/her position prior to completion of shift.
  • Responsible for accurate and complete data entry for the shift. This will also include State Run Report data entry as assigned.
  • Responsible for generating applicable reports and checking for accuracy.
  • Assists in locating scene of incidents and selecting the safest, fastest route to such scene using all available locator aids.
  • Relays instructions from supervisors, messages and emergency information.
  • Maintains a current working knowledge of all company policies, procedures, rules, regulations, and memorandums.
  • Follows established parameters/formats in receiving requests for service.
  • Responsible for knowledge and use of equipment, including but not limited to the computer, printers, 911 equipment, recording devices, telephones, and other equipment as assigned by superiors.

Minimum Required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Must have minimal medical training or telecommunications experience or, have at least one year's experience as an EMS or public safety dispatcher.
  • Skilled in reading and writing English.
  • Ability to communicate clearly on the radio and telephone.
  • Ability to record, transmit, and report information accurately.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Possess good typing skills with speed and accuracy necessary to efficiently process emergency and nonemergency calls.
  • Ability to understand basic computer applications.
